Senior Consultant, Talent Services

Sue Sherr-Seitz

Baltimore, MD

Sue brings nearly 30 years of leadership experience in nonprofit talent development, fundraising, and turnaround management to her clients at Evolve. She specializes in placing leaders in CEO, C-Suite, Development, and Operations positions at Jewish organizations, with deep expertise in JCCs, Jewish Federations, and complex national systems. Clients value her responsiveness, proactive approach, and dedication to exceeding expectations, ensuring an exceptional experience. By combining passion and skill to connect promising leaders with inspirational organizations, Sue excels in cultivating a strong pool of candidates and supporting their success by thoroughly understanding the needs of both candidates and client partners. 

Previously, Sue recruited C-Suite leaders for Jewish Federations and Foundations at DRG Talent Advisory Group. She has held executive management, fundraising, strategic planning, and talent management positions at the JCC of Greater Baltimore, Jewish Federations of North America, and UJA-Federation of New York. 

Sue holds a Master of Science in Social Work from the Columbia School of Social Work, a Master of Arts from the Jewish Theological Seminary of America, and a Bachelor of Science from the University of Maryland.
